AI Summary
-
Directs the Department of Environmental Protection (DEP) to develop an AI-based tool for predicting and mapping flood risk at the block or neighborhood level throughout New Jersey
-
Requires the tool to incorporate satellite imagery, historical and projected rainfall data, climate models, river height monitors, meteorological sensors, and FEMA floodplain maps
-
Mandates the DEP make the AI tool available to municipalities, county planning agencies, emergency management officials, and the public
-
Authorizes DEP to enter agreements through competitive bidding with public and private entities, including universities, to develop the tool, with contract awards required within 60 days of receiving proposals
-
Permits establishment of a grant program to fund entities contributing technical expertise, data, or infrastructure to the AI tool, with all agreements and awards publicly disclosed
Legislative Description
Directs DEP to establish artificial intelligence flood prediction and mapping tool.
